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.
Configurazione di un cluster Slurm in Studio
Le seguenti istruzioni descrivono come configurare un cluster HyperPod Slurm in Studio.
-
Crea un dominio o tienine uno pronto. Per informazioni sulla creazione di un dominio, consulta Guida alla configurazione con Amazon SageMaker AI.
-
(Facoltativo) Crea e allega un volume personalizzato FSx per Lustre al tuo dominio.
-
Assicurati che il tuo file system FSx Lustre esista nello stesso VPC del dominio previsto e si trovi in una delle sottoreti presenti nel dominio.
-
Puoi seguire le istruzioni in Aggiunta di un file system personalizzato a un dominio.
-
-
(Facoltativo) Consigliamo di aggiungere tag ai cluster per garantire un flusso di lavoro più fluido. Per informazioni su come aggiungere tag, consulta Modifica un SageMaker HyperPod cluster Aggiornare il cluster utilizzando la console AI. SageMaker
-
Aggiungi il tuo file system FSx for Lustre al tuo dominio Studio. Questo consente di identificare il file system durante l’avvio degli spazi di Studio. A tale scopo, aggiungi il seguente tag al cluster per identificarlo con l'ID del FSx filesystem,.
fs-idChiave tag = “
hyperpod-cluster-filesystem”, valore tag = “fs-id”. -
Tagga lo spazio di lavoro Grafana gestito da Amazon al tuo dominio Studio. Così facendo, puoi collegare in modo rapido e diretto lo spazio di lavoro Grafana dal cluster in Studio. A tale scopo, aggiungi il tag seguente al cluster per identificarlo con l’ID dello spazio di lavoro Grafana,
ws-id.Chiave tag = “
grafana-workspace”, valore tag = “ws-id”.
-
-
Aggiungi l’autorizzazione seguente al tuo ruolo di esecuzione.
Per informazioni sui ruoli di esecuzione dell' SageMaker IA e su come modificarli, consulta. Informazioni sulle autorizzazioni e sui ruoli di esecuzione dello spazio del dominio
Per informazioni su come collegare le policy a un utente o a un gruppo IAM, consulta Adding and removing IAM identity permissions.
-
Aggiungi un tag a questo ruolo IAM, con Chiave tag = “
SSMSessionRunAs” e valore tag = “os user”.os userqui corrisponde allo stesso utente configurato per il cluster Slurm. Gestisci l'accesso ai SageMaker HyperPod cluster a livello di ruolo o utente IAM utilizzando la funzionalità Run As in AWS Systems ManagerAgent (SSM Agent). Con questa funzionalità, puoi avviare ogni sessione SSM utilizzando l’utente del sistema operativo (OS) associato al ruolo o all’utente IAM.Per informazioni su come aggiungere tag al ruolo di esecuzione, consulta Tag IAM roles.
-
Attiva il supporto per Esegui come per i nodi gestiti di Linux e macOS. Le impostazioni Esegui come sono valide per l’intero account e sono necessarie per avviare correttamente tutte le sessioni SSM.
-
(Facoltativo) Limitazione della visualizzazione delle attività nei cluster Studio per Slurm. Per informazioni sulle attività visibili in Studio, consulta Processi.
In Amazon SageMaker Studio puoi navigare per visualizzare i tuoi cluster in HyperPod cluster (in Compute).
Limitazione della visualizzazione delle attività nei cluster Studio per Slurm
Puoi impostare una limitazione che consente agli utenti di visualizzare solo le attività Slurm per le quali dispongono di autorizzazioni, senza richiedere l’immissione manuale di namespace o ulteriori controlli delle autorizzazioni. La limitazione viene applicata in base al ruolo IAM degli utenti, fornendo loro un’esperienza semplificata e sicura. La sezione seguente fornisce informazioni su come limitare la visualizzazione delle attività nei cluster Studio per Slurm. Per informazioni sulle attività visibili in Studio, consulta Processi.
Per impostazione predefinita, tutti gli utenti di Studio possono visualizzare, gestire e interagire con tutte le attività del cluster Slurm. Per limitare questo limite, puoi gestire l'accesso ai SageMaker HyperPod cluster a livello di ruolo o utente IAM utilizzando la funzionalità Run As in AWS Systems Manager Agent (SSM Agent).
Puoi farlo taggando i ruoli IAM con identificatori specifici, come il nome utente o il gruppo. Quando un utente accede a Studio, Gestione sessioni utilizza la funzionalità Esegui come per eseguire i comandi come account utente Slurm specifico che corrisponde ai tag del ruolo IAM. La configurazione Slurm può essere impostata per limitare la visibilità delle attività in base all’account utente. L’interfaccia utente di Studio filtrerà automaticamente le attività visibili all’account dell’utente specifico quando i comandi vengono eseguiti con la funzionalità Esegui come. Al termine della configurazione, Una ogni utente che assume il ruolo con gli identificatori specificati vedrà le attività Slurm filtrate in base alla configurazione Slurm. Per informazioni su come aggiungere tag al ruolo di esecuzione, consulta Tag IAM roles.